ORMHOF inductee Brian Chuchua, Class of 1978, drops some cherry bombs on us as he tells the Jeep history from the beginning. From paying $5,000 for a Jeep franchise to participating in year 2 of Jeep Jamboree to racing the first Mexican 1000 and founding SEMA. 5:09 – education today is not career-advancing, for sure
10:59 – I was drag racing my Jeep with the V8 at all the local drag strips
14:28 – I made the cover of Popular Mechanics
17:24 – the Pan American highway existed, but the bridges did not, so you had to ford all these rivers
25:15 – I drove my Jeep up the steps of the Sydney Opera House
30:09 – we built the first Blazer and sold the name to Chevrolet
36:54 – the original SEMA was to fight the legislation on wheels
